When and where to leave the letter?

    I have finally written a letter that I am some-what ok with and I have it sitting in my room, waiting to be given to my mother. My mother is off from work today and tomorrow. My plan is for her to read it tomorrow, but I have no idea when to leave it out or where to leave it because she's home all day. Should I wait until she goes to work? I just don't want her to have the thought of me running thorough her head all day making her crazy.

    I would do it when she isn't stressed/irritated, so if you wait until she goes back to work, she might be stressed in the morning going to work/irritated coming back, which won't help you... Maybe you should just give it to her and tell her to read it in a quiet place, and come back to you when she's ready? IDK, do it/give it to her, the moment you feel is the best moment Good luck :slight_smile: BTW, make sure you're 100%, or at least 99.9% sure about the letter :slight_smile: keep us posted :slight_smile:

    If you can't stand sitting there while she reads it, maybe give it to her before you're about to step in the shower, or when you're going out for a bit. I like whattodoii's idea of asking her to leave the room then come to you.

    I wouldn't suggest waiting until she goes back to work.. try to find a time when she's not too busy. This will give her plenty of time to read it and discuss it with you after. I would probably wait until later in the evening, that way it's not interfering with the rest of the day.

    Best of luck to you! I'd love to hear how it goes. :slight_smile:
